May 2025 - Apr 2026Church Street area has the 4th highest crime rate of 60 local areas in City Centre , and the 4th highest crime rate of 447 local areas in Preston .
Crime levels at this postcode are much higher than in the adjoining streets, suggesting that most neighbouring areas are relatively safer than this one.
The overall crime rate in the area around Church Street (PR1 3BS) in the last 12 months was 2143.8 per 1,000 residents and was 445.9% higher than the City Centre average (392.7 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 115 offences recorded. The least common crime was Burglary with 2 cases , up 100.0% compared to 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Bicycle theft ( 200.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Anti-social behaviour ( -29.9% YoY).
Violent crimes totalled 158 (≈ 987.5 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were rising ( 7.5%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-47.7% comparing early vs recent averages) .
In the area around Church Street (PR1 3BS), the main crime hotspot is near Stanley Street. Police recorded 113 crimes here, including 72 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
